Torre le Nocelle, Campania, Italy
Overview
Torre le Nocelle is a charming hilltop village in Campania, renowned for its picturesque landscapes and local wine production. Its intimate size offers an authentic taste of rural Italian life, with friendly locals and traditional festivals.
Best Time to Visit
April-June for spring blossoms and grapevines; September-October during harvest season.
Local Tips
Public transport is limited, so renting a car is recommended for exploring nearby towns and countryside. Most shops close midday for 'riposo.'
Cultural Etiquette
Dress modestly, especially when visiting churches. Tipping is appreciated but not obligatory; rounding up the bill in restaurants is customary.
Safety Warnings
Generally very safe; be cautious of poorly lit rural roads at night and mind your belongings in busy market areas.
Hidden Gems
Don't miss the quiet trails behind Contrada Bosco or the lesser-known historic crypt in the main church. Ask locals about cellar tours in small family wineries.
